Stefys is a modern, creative variation derived from the Greek name Stephanos, meaning 'crown' or 'wreath.' Historically, crowns symbolized victory and honor in ancient Greece, often awarded to victors in athletic or poetic competitions. This name embodies triumph, dignity, and a regal stature, connecting to a timeless tradition of achievement and respect.

Cultural Significance of Stefys

The name Stefys, rooted in the tradition of the Greek 'Stephanos,' carries the cultural weight of ancient Greek victory wreaths. Such crowns were awarded to champions and heroes, symbolizing honor and achievement. Over centuries, derivatives like Stephanie became popular across Europe, often associated with royalty and saints, representing a blend of spiritual triumph and worldly success.

Saint Stephen

The first Christian martyr, whose name derives from the Greek 'Stephanos', symbolizing the crown of martyrdom.

Stephen of Byzantium

A Greek grammarian and geographer known for his valuable contributions to ancient geography and lexicography.

Stephen I of Hungary

The first King of Hungary who established Christianity as the state religion and consolidated the Hungarian state.

Stefania Sandrelli

Iconic Italian actress whose name variation is close to Stefys, known for her work in European cinema.

Stephanie de Beauharnais

Adopted daughter of Napoleon Bonaparte and Grand Duchess of Baden, an influential historical figure in European nobility.
